fix(generator): устранён флаки runtime-гейта стыка backfill/live
- Зачем:
- гейт generated-history-runtime-check падал через раз: docker compose
stop убивал генератор SIGKILL'ом посреди batch (SIGTERM не ловился),
непарные строки маскировались под «смену фактуры» (задача 20).
- Что:
- генератор грациозно завершается по SIGTERM: текущий batch дописывается
во все топики с flush и записью history; compose даёт минуту grace.
- runtime-check ждёт пересекающий визит в STG (предусловие проверки),
seam-check получил precheck непарных live-строк; в STG-запросах
закреплён 'UTC' против сдвига наивных меток в поясе сервера.
- контрактные тесты усилены, задача 20 закрыта, блокер задачи 13 снят.
- Проверка:
- тесты: 192 passed (generator), 21 passed (контракты);
- стенд: 3 подряд зелёных make generated-history-runtime-check;
красный сценарий (искажение referer_url пересекающего визита) валит
гейт прежним сообщением при нулевых непарных счётчиках.
